Having both experienced player what WW1 generals argued cowardly pilots would do if given parachutes and having struggled to keep a badly crippled aircraft in the air only to not be able to stop it spinning and ploughing into the ground, I feel that their should be some reward for manageing to keep a flying seive under enough control to gain enough height to bale out, the "Microsoft" ejector seat allowing enough time. Does it really need to ask a player, "Are you sure??"
In Il-2 and 1946, trying to survive long enough to bale out over (A) friendly lines and (B) high enough for the parachute to open are essential to survival in a career game. Perhaps a bitched bale out or failed bale out (pilot dead) should have a longer respawn time, with a really long respawn time for chickens leaving an airworthy aircraft. Another problem with baling out is that bomber's defnsive guns continue firing after the crews have baled.... something that needs fixing, along with the P-51, Fw.190, etc. incorrect flight models bugs. I'm used to nursing badly shot up aitcraft home on IL-2 and 1946, not to mention Red Baron just to preserve a career. A lot of the problem is that in realsitic and simulator modes, some aircraft have such unstable flight models that it doesn't take much to loose control so a few few choice holes, plus the tendency for players to dogfight below 1,000 Feet doesn't allow for time to regain control when the aircraft freaks out. I've even crashed in seconds when large chunks of control surfaces have been taken out suddenly when flying close to the deck. It should still count as a kill as the aircraft was force to crash.
